Estimated Price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(smaller scope)
$3,000 - $6,500 (larger scope)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Minor Pothole Repair | $1,200 - $2,000 |
| Crack Filling | $1,300 - $2,800 |
| Surface Resurfacing | $3,000 - $5,500 |
| Full Depth Repair | $4,000 - $6,500 |
| Pavement Replacement | $6,000 - $12,000 |
Factors Affecting Cost
Uneven pavement patches can pose safety hazards and affect the appearance of walkways and driveways. Repairing uneven pavement in Kingston, WA, involves various factors that influence project costs and scope. Understanding key considerations can help in comparing options and planning repairs effectively.
- Materials used: Common materials include asphalt, concrete, or patching compounds, each with different durability and cost implications.
- Size and scope: Repairs can range from small patches to extensive resurfacing, impacting overall project complexity.
- Labor complexity: The level of difficulty depends on the extent of unevenness and the underlying cause, affecting labor time and expertise required.
- Permitting requirements: Larger repairs or those involving significant alterations may require permits from local authorities in Kingston, WA.
- Additional features or services: Options such as leveling, sealing, or reinforcement can add to the project scope and costs.
Project Size and Scope
Uneven Pavement Repair
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Minor surface unevenness (e.g., small bumps or dips) | $200 - $500 |
| Moderate unevenness affecting pavement surface | $500 - $1,500 |
| Large areas with significant unevenness or cracking | $1,500 - $4,000 |
| Complete pavement leveling or replacement | $4,000 and up |
In Kingston, WA, project costs for uneven pavement repair can vary based on the extent of the unevenness and the size of the area needing repair.
